U.S. issues new sanctions against Iran

  1. Politics
May 30, 2018 - 21:21

The U.S. Treasury Department announced Wednesday that Washington had imposed new sanctions on Iran. In particular, the U.S. sanctioned six individuals and three companies.

According to the US Treasury Department's statement, Washington is targeting the Ansar-e Hezbollah organization and the Hanista programming group with their punitive measures.
